1985 Renault Siete vs. 2009 Renault Clio
To start off, 2009 Renault Clio is newer by 24 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1985 Renault Siete.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1985 Renault Siete would be higher. At 1,149 cc (4 cylinders), 2009 Renault Clio is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2009 Renault Clio (60 HP @ 5250 RPM) has 16 more horse power than 1985 Renault Siete. (44 HP @ 4400 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2009 Renault Clio should accelerate faster than 1985 Renault Siete.
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2009 Renault Clio (94 Nm @ 2500 RPM) has 10 more torque (in Nm) than 1985 Renault Siete. (84 Nm @ 2000 RPM). This means 2009 Renault Clio will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1985 Renault Siete.
